Life Class is Pat Barker's powerful & unforgettable story of art & war. Spring 1914. The students at the Slade School of Art gather in Henry Tonks' studio for his life-drawing class. But for Paul Tarrant the class is troubling underscoring his own uncertainty about making a mark on the world. When war breaks out & the army won't take Paul he enlists in the Belgian Red Cross just as he & fellow student Elinor Brooke admit their feelings for one another. Amidst the devastation in Ypres Paul comes to see the world anew
- but have his experiences changed him completely? Triumphant shattering inspiring". (The Times). " Barker writes as brilliantly as ever.. .with great tenderness & insight she conveys a wartime world turned upside down". (Independent on Sunday). " Vigorous masterly gripping". (Penelope Lively Independent). " Extraordinarily powerful". (Sunday Telegraph). Pat Barker was born in 1943. Her books include the highly acclaimed Regeneration trilogy comprising Regeneration which has been filmed The Eye in the Door which won the Guardian Fiction Prize & The Ghost Road which won the Booker Prize. The trilogy featured the Observer's 2012 list of the ten best historical novels. She is also the author of the more recent novels Another World Border Crossing Double Vision Life Class & Toby's Room. She lives in Durham."

In 1988 Rosemary Bailey & her husband were travelling in the French Pyrenees when they fell in love with & subsequently bought a ruined medieval monastery surrounded by peach orchards & snow-capped peaks. Traces of the monks were everywhere in the frescoed 13th century chapel the buried crypt & the stone arches of the cloister. For the next few years the couple visited Corbiac whenever they could until 1997 they took the plunge & moved from central London to rural France with their six-year-old son. Entirely reliant on their earnings as freelance writers they put their Apple Macs in the room with the fewest leaks & sent Theo to the village school. With vision & determination they have restored the monastery to its former glory testing their relationship & resolve to the limit & finding unexpected inspiration in the place. This book is not just Rosemary Baileys account of the challenges of life in a small mountain community but also a celebration of the rugged beauty of French Catalonia the pleasures of Catalan cooking & an exploration of an alternative often magical world. ...

Reptiles & amphibians ruled the world for nearly 200 million years & today there are still over 12 500 of them. Some are huge the deadliest creatures on earth. Some are tiny among the strangest to be found anywhere. Together they not only outnumber mammals or birds but in their colourful variety & extraordinary behaviour they far surpass them. So where did these ancient creatures come from? How have they transformed themselves into the bizarre & beautiful forms that are alive today? & whats the secret of their epic success? In Life in Cold Blood David traces the story of their evolution & overturns the myth that these creatures are just primitive killers to reveal them for what they truly are. ...
